WebMar 6, 2024 · Once you sense he’s comfortable inside the crate, feed him in there with the door open. Once he’s comfortably eating in the crate, close the door. Don’t go far and keep an eye on him. At some point he’ll realize the door is closed and he’s inside. Try to ignore any whimpering or barking. Once he’s calm, open the door and praise him. WebMay 2, 2024 · Aim for just 10-15 seconds or so to start. Then open the door, trade them for the toy using a few treats outside of the crate, and remove the stuffed toy. Hang out near the crate doing nothing for about 10 seconds, and then repeat! Add on more time in the crate with the door closed as they progress.

WebMar 27, 2024 · Leave the crate door open and allow your pup to explore. Put in some treats and create an inviting environment. Talk in a friendly voice and praise your dog when it goes inside. If your dog is hesitant, do not push it in. Be patient and allow time to adjust. Establish a crate command and be consistent so your dog enters the crate on-demand. WebFeb 10, 2013 · It is important that during their crate time they have access to water; a stainless steel pail hooked to the side of the crate or crate door works best. Young puppies require more frequent potty breaks than adults. Puppy ages and their relative maximum crating times are: 8–10 weeks: 30–60 minutes. 11–14 weeks: 1–3 hours.
